How is sunlight used in photosynthesis? Sunlight controls the amount of water in plant cells. Sunlight is a nutrient for plants.

Sunlight is converted to chemical energy. Sunlight breaks cell walls to allow energy in and out
Biology
2 answers:
Leno4ka [110]4 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Just looking at these answers none of them seem particularly right as sunlight is used as the energy source to make glucose meaning that it is used as energy to bond hydrogen, carbon, and oxygen. The most right answer however i think is that it is converted into chemical energy.
